Commit 8a6093daf9aef603ab95ec87b3af4f699168374f
1 parent
30ead0b8
Exists in
master
and in
5 other branches
Incluindo construção dos .def para msvc no processo de compilação windows, adici…
…onando .def gerados no instalador do sdk
Showing
5 changed files
with
12 additions
and
7 deletions
Show diff stats
configure.ac
... | ... | @@ -103,6 +103,7 @@ EXEEXT="" |
103 | 103 | DLLPREFIX="lib" |
104 | 104 | PLUGINS="" |
105 | 105 | APP_GUI_SRC="" |
106 | +LDLIBFLAGS="" | |
106 | 107 | |
107 | 108 | if test $host != $build; then |
108 | 109 | AC_CHECK_PROGS(HOST_CC, gcc cc) |
... | ... | @@ -122,6 +123,7 @@ case "$host" in |
122 | 123 | DLL_FLAGS="-shared -Wl,--add-stdcall-alias" |
123 | 124 | LDSOFLAGS="-Wl,-soname,\`basename \$@\`" |
124 | 125 | LDAPPFLAGS="-mwindows" |
126 | + LDLIBFLAGS="-Wl,--output-def,\$@.def" | |
125 | 127 | DBGRPATH="" |
126 | 128 | DLLDIR="" |
127 | 129 | DBGCMDPREFIX="" |
... | ... | @@ -315,6 +317,7 @@ AC_SUBST(DLL_CFLAGS) |
315 | 317 | AC_SUBST(DLLDIR) |
316 | 318 | AC_SUBST(LDSOFLAGS) |
317 | 319 | AC_SUBST(LDAPPFLAGS) |
320 | +AC_SUBST(LDLIBFLAGS) | |
318 | 321 | AC_SUBST(DBGRPATH) |
319 | 322 | AC_SUBST(DBGCMDPREFIX) |
320 | 323 | AC_SUBST(LDARCH) | ... | ... |
po/pt_BR.po
... | ... | @@ -5,8 +5,8 @@ msgid "" |
5 | 5 | msgstr "" |
6 | 6 | "Project-Id-Version: pw3270 5.0\n" |
7 | 7 | "Report-Msgid-Bugs-To: \n" |
8 | -"POT-Creation-Date: 2013-02-25 08:36-0300\n" | |
9 | -"PO-Revision-Date: 2013-02-25 08:31-0300\n" | |
8 | +"POT-Creation-Date: 2013-02-25 14:45-0300\n" | |
9 | +"PO-Revision-Date: 2013-02-25 14:46-0300\n" | |
10 | 10 | "Last-Translator: Perry Werneck <perry.werneck@gmail.com>\n" |
11 | 11 | "Language-Team: Português <>\n" |
12 | 12 | "Language: pt_BR\n" |
... | ... | @@ -243,7 +243,6 @@ msgid "Auto-Reconnect" |
243 | 243 | msgstr "Reconectar automaticamente" |
244 | 244 | |
245 | 245 | #: filetransfer.c:782 |
246 | -#, fuzzy | |
247 | 246 | msgid "Avblock" |
248 | 247 | msgstr "Avblock" |
249 | 248 | ... | ... |
pw3270.nsi.in
... | ... | @@ -163,6 +163,9 @@ Section /o "Software Development Kit" SecSDK |
163 | 163 | file "/oname=$INSTDIR\sdk\sample\Makefile" "src\sample\Makefile" |
164 | 164 | file "/oname=$INSTDIR\sdk\sample\connect.c" "src\sample\connect.c" |
165 | 165 | |
166 | + file "/oname=$INSTDIR\sdk\lib3270.def" ".bin\Release\lib3270.dll.@PACKAGE_VERSION@.def" | |
167 | + file "/oname=$INSTDIR\sdk\libhllapi.def" ".bin\Release\libhllapi.dll.def" | |
168 | + | |
166 | 169 | SectionEnd |
167 | 170 | |
168 | 171 | # create a section to define what the uninstaller does. | ... | ... |
src/lib3270/Makefile.in
... | ... | @@ -125,7 +125,7 @@ $(BINDBG)/@DLLPREFIX@3270@DLLEXT@: $(BINDBG)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 |
125 | 125 | $(BINDBG)/@DLLPREFIX@3270@DLLEXT@.@VERSION@: $(foreach SRC, $(basename $(SOURCES)), $(OBJDBG)/$(SRC)@OBJEXT@) |
126 | 126 | @echo " CCLD `basename $@`" |
127 | 127 | @$(MKDIR) `dirname $@` |
128 | - @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 -o $@ $^ $(LIBS) | |
128 | + @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 @LDLIBFLAGS@ -o $@ $^ $(LIBS) | |
129 | 129 | |
130 | 130 | $(BINRLS)/@DLLPREFIX@3270@DLLEXT@: $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 |
131 | 131 | @rm -f $@ |
... | ... | @@ -134,7 +134,7 @@ $(BINRLS)/@DLLPREFIX@3270@DLLEXT@: $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@ |
134 | 134 | $(BINRLS)/@DLLPREFIX@3270@DLLEXT@.@VERSION@: $(foreach SRC, $(basename $(SOURCES)), $(OBJRLS)/$(SRC)@OBJEXT@) |
135 | 135 | @echo " CCLD `basename $@`" |
136 | 136 | @$(MKDIR) `dirname $@` |
137 | - @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 -o $@ $^ $(LIBS) | |
137 | + @$(LD) $(DLL_FLAGS) $(LDFLAGS) @LDSOFLAGS@ @LDLIBFLAGS@ -o $@ $^ $(LIBS) | |
138 | 138 | @$(STRIP) $@ |
139 | 139 | |
140 | 140 | $(BINDBG)/testprogram$(EXEEXT): $(OBJDBG)/testprogram.o $(foreach SRC, $(basename $(SOURCES)), $(OBJDBG)/$(SRC)@OBJEXT@) | ... | ... |
src/plugins/remotectl/Makefile.in
... | ... | @@ -108,7 +108,7 @@ $(BINRLS)/plugins/$(MODULE_NAME)@DLLEXT@: $(foreach SRC, $(basename $(PLUGIN_SRC |
108 | 108 | $(BINRLS)/libhllapi@DLLEXT@: $(foreach SRC, $(basename $(HLLAPI_SRC)), $(OBJRLS)/$(SRC).o) |
109 | 109 | @echo " CCLD `basename $@`" |
110 | 110 | @$(MKDIR) `dirname $@` |
111 | - @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) -o $@ $^ $(LIBS) | |
111 | + @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) @LDLIBFLAGS@ -o $@ $^ $(LIBS) | |
112 | 112 | |
113 | 113 | #---[ Debug targets ]---------------------------------------------------------- |
114 | 114 | |
... | ... | @@ -122,7 +122,7 @@ $(BINDBG)/plugins/$(MODULE_NAME)@DLLEXT@: $(foreach SRC, $(basename $(PLUGIN_SRC |
122 | 122 | $(BINDBG)/libhllapi@DLLEXT@: $(foreach SRC, $(basename $(HLLAPI_SRC)), $(OBJDBG)/$(SRC).o) |
123 | 123 | @echo " CCLD `basename $@`" |
124 | 124 | @$(MKDIR) `dirname $@` |
125 | - @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) -o $@ $^ $(LIBS) | |
125 | + @$(LD) $(DLL_FLAGS) @LDSOFLAGS@ $(LDFLAGS) @LDLIBFLAGS@ -o $@ $^ $(LIBS) | |
126 | 126 | |
127 | 127 | #---[ Misc targets ]----------------------------------------------------------- |
128 | 128 | ... | ... |